Профессия программист: кто это, что делает, где учиться, зарплата, как стать и что сдавать

Профессия программист: кто это, что делает, где учиться, зарплата, как стать и что сдавать

Эта информация даст вам общие знания о том, как можно стать программистом в одной из современных сфер разработки. Python просто выучить, даже если вы никогда не программировали. Во время обучения вам будет помогать эксперт-куратор. Вы разработаете 3 ошибка разработчика проекта для портфолио, а Центр карьеры поможет найти работу Python-разработчиком. Для эксперта больше важны хард-скиллы в выбранном направлении, а для руководителя — софты. Например, программист может самостоятельно написать целый проект за полгода, но совсем не умеет отказывать смежникам, которые пытаются отвлечь его на свои задачи.

За сколько можно стать программистом с нуля

Зарплаты обычно выше средних на рынке, а от самого разработчика требуется терпение и исполнительность. Мы уже разобрались, как можно стать Java программистом с нуля — поговорим прицельно о роли языка в бэкенде. Чтобы стать программистом, практика является самой важной частью помимо обучения.

Как стать программистом, если нет времени посещать офлайн-мероприятия для обучения?

Рассказывается, какими качествами должен обладать специалист этой сферы, что нужно делать, чтобы им стать. Чтобы стать программистом, нужно развивать свои навыки изо дня в день, из года в год. Программирование может приносить удовольствие и пользу (для разума, духа и финансовую). В этой статье мы не приводим методы, которые позволили бы вам магическим образом превратиться в специалиста, и последовательность шагов необязательно должна быть такой.

Бесплатные курсы по программированию от Нетологии

Возможно, более молодые обучающиеся обойдут вас в креативности и скорости решения конкретных задач, но это не означает, что вам не удастся освоить новую профессию. На изучение основ программирования будет достаточно 2-3 месяцев. Но учиться программисту необходимо постоянно, поскольку старые знания быстро устаревают и требуется дополнительное обучение. Нередко пользователи хотят знать, как стать программистом с нуля самостоятельно без профессионального обучения.

Учебные пособия для овладения профессией программиста с 10-20 лет и к более взрослым разработчикам

В перспективном направлении можно быстро построить успешную карьеру, и вы еще успеете достичь высот в новой для вас отрасли, если даже попадете в нее, когда вам за 40. Ассоциация компаний – разработчиков ПО РУССОФТ составила рейтинг российских вузов по подготовке ИТ-специалистов. Уровень обучения программистов в университетах оценивали директора отечественных софтверных компаний. В топ-50 по мнению работодателей вошли более трех десятков региональных вузов.

Реальные предприниматели делятся опытом

Если вы изучаете программирование сами и хотите быстро начать работать — начните с PHP. Tango with Django — это хорошая возможность подтянуть английский и одновременно получить понимание того, как устроены веб-проекты и как всё работает. Самые перспективные языки программирования — Ruby, Java, Python, Node.JS (Javascript для сервера). Этого будет достаточно для следующих шагов.Возможно на этом этапе вы захотите остановиться и изучить CSS подробнее.

Эту престижную профессию выбирают всё больше молодых людей. Программисты в возрасте либо уходят на руководящие должности, либо становятся экспертами. Сам я считаю, что программированием можно заниматься пусть и не до глубокой старости, но по крайней мере намного дольше, чем профессиональным спортом. Разрабатывают программное обеспечение прикладного характера — игры‚ бухгалтерские программы‚ редакторы‚ мессенджеры и т. Также они адаптируют уже существующие программы под нужды конкретной организации или пользователя. Если после пары бесплатных курсов окончательно понятно, что программирование привлекает, то уволиться с работы можно.

Как самостоятельно стать программистом с нуля

  • Такой тип разработчиков – как вы скорее всего уже поняли – отвечает за создание программного обеспечения.
  • Обучение Python ещё никогда не было настолько простым.
  • При обучении используйте все материалы, сервисы и знания других людей, которые будут доступны.
  • Надо указать свои знания и навыки, но не на несколько страниц, а коротко, четко и лаконично.
  • Algorithms Specialization (Stanford) — введение в алгоритмы для тех, кто имеет хотя бы небольшой опыт программирования.

Друзья, изучая и обучая программированию, я пересмотрел сотни материалов и различных курсов. Меня часто спрашивают, с чего лучше начать, какой волшебный курс поможет при освоить программирование с нуля или со школьными знаниями. Эксперт (или Individual Contributor, IC) — это специалист, который уходит вглубь технических компетенций. Он решает всё более сложные задачи, берётся за большие проекты, изучает новые технологии и повышает скорость своей работы.

Некоторые онлайн-школы помогают выпускникам с последующим трудоустройством. Но в государственные компании до сих пор не берут без диплома, каким бы опытом ни обладал потенциальный сотрудник. Даже senior может не получить желаемую должность, если у него нет «корочки». Сеньоры – высшая ступень, достичь которой не так-то просто. Сеньор не просто умеет писать оптимизированный код и знает, что этот код делает. Он еще и понимает, что происходит в системе во время работы программы, и как сделать так, чтобы она выполнялась быстрее и потребляла меньше ресурсов.

как стать программистом самостоятельно

Различие во времени между различными способами может составлять годы или месяцы. Таким образом, выбирайте то, что наиболее комфортно для вас. Он используется для разработки смарт-контрактов в сети Эфириума. Рост популярности криптовалют и блокчейна привёл к высокому спросу на Solidity-разработчиков, поэтому мы не могли обойти его стороной.

Важно прокачивать технический английский, чтобы ориентироваться в англоязычной документации. Программист – это человек, который разрабатывает программы и алгоритмы для решения определенных задач. В своей работе он использует математическое моделирование, на основе которого пишет код. Продуктами работы программистов могут быть компьютерные игры и операционные системы, сайты и приложения. Многие крупные компании для разработки разных систем нередко заказывают нескольких программистов, каждый из которых отвечает за определенное направление. Это часть сервиса, которую видит пользователь (меню, форма для обратной связи с консультантом, внешний вид ресурса).

Я очень люблю программировать и создавать то, что будет полезно людям. И тут я столкнулся с одной проблемой — поиск партнера по теннису. Сервисов по поиску в интернете очень мало, а то что есть, скажем честно, очень плохого качества. Сайты оформлены в тематике 2000-х годов, очень мало функционала на сайте, как и количество представленных там людей.

После того, как вы выбрали сферу программирования, выберите язык, который будете изучать. Например, если вы выбрали веб-разработку, то начните изучение Python, PHP или Java. Только через практику можно освоить программирование. Многие считают PHP «не совсем настоящим» языком программирования и для этого есть основания. PHP редко используется в крупных веб-приложениях и заточен только для веб — использовать его в других областях не получится. Другой путь — начать с PHP и работы с популярными CMS.

Так происходит каждый раз, и все время программист пытается усовершенствовать свои творения. Если не практиковаться, вся теория со временем забудется. Для самых юных разработчиков, которые только познают азы, предлагается ознакомиться с «Образовательной робототехникой Lego WeDo».

Ведь наставник будет заниматься с одним учеником, уделяя ему больше времени. Такая деятельность распространена и в интернете, и в реальной жизни. Сегодня их предостаточно, как в реальных условиях, так и в сети. Курсы чаще всего не бесплатные, но зато организаторы смогут предложить ученику эффективную программу обучения. Это позволит подготовиться к программированию за короткое время.

как стать программистом самостоятельно

Плюс в том, что на таких сайтах собрано огромное количество вакансий, есть удобные фильтры для поиска, а искать можно по всей России и за ее пределами. Минус — не все компании пользуются подобными сервисами, потому что размещение на них платное. А если организация небольшая и ищет молодого специалиста или стажера, то ей не всегда выгодно размещаться на HH.

IT курсы онлайн от лучших специалистов в своей отросли https://deveducation.com/ here.

Vanshi_Admin

Leave a Reply

Your email address will not be published. Required fields are makes.